Healthy Oatmeal Cookies

Healthy Oatmeal Cookies are a delicious and guilt-free treat that combines wholesome ingredients for a chewy, flavorful experience. These cookies are perfect for satisfying your sweet tooth while providing essential nutrients. Ingredients

Scale
  • 1 cup old-fashioned rolled oats
  • 1 cup whole wheat flour
  • 1/3 cup maple syrup
  • 2 ripe bananas, mashed
  • 1/4 cup melted coconut oil
  • 1/2 cup dark chocolate chips
  • 1/2 cup chopped nuts or dried fruits (optional)

Instructions

  1. Preheat oven to 350°F (175°C) and line two baking sheets with parchment paper.
  2. In a large bowl, mash the bananas until smooth. Stir in melted coconut oil and maple syrup until well combined.
  3. Add rolled oats and whole wheat flour, mixing gently to avoid overmixing; the mixture should remain chunky.
  4. Fold in dark chocolate chips and optional nuts or dried fruits.
  5. Scoop tablespoon-sized portions onto prepared baking sheets, spacing them about two inches apart. Flatten slightly.
  6. Bake for 10-12 minutes until edges are golden brown. Cool on baking sheets for a few minutes before transferring to wire racks.
